
A New Era for the Chicago Bears? Matt Campbell Eyed for Coaching Role
In a development that could redefine the trajectory of the Chicago Bears, the franchise is considering a significant change at the helm. Iowa State's esteemed head coach, Matt Campbell, has emerged as a leading candidate for their coaching vacancy. This potential shift comes in the wake of the Bears parting ways with Matt Eberflus, who left the organization with a less-than-stellar 14-32 record.
Matt Campbell's Legacy at Iowa State
Matt Campbell's tenure at Iowa State, beginning in 2016, has been nothing short of remarkable. Over the years, he has transformed the Cyclones into a formidable force in college football. Under his leadership, Iowa State achieved an enviable 62-50 record, securing five consecutive winning seasons—a first in the school's history. Campbell's strategic acumen and ability to cultivate talent have made him the most successful coach in Iowa State's storied past.
One of the highlights of Campbell's career was leading Iowa State to its first-ever 10-win season in 2024. That same year, the Cyclones made their second appearance in the Big 12 Championship Game in just six years, further solidifying Campbell's reputation as a top-tier coach. Recognizing his contributions and potential, Iowa State secured Campbell's services through 2032 with an eight-year contract extension signed in December.
The Chicago Bears' Transition
The Chicago Bears, navigating a period of transition, concluded the 2024 season with a 4-8 record, following a 7-10 outcome in the previous campaign. This downturn necessitated a reevaluation of leadership, prompting Eberflus' departure. To bridge the gap, the organization appointed Thomas Brown as the interim head coach. Previously serving as the Bears' pass game coordinator, Brown quickly stepped into his new role with vigor. Under his guidance, the Bears ended their season on a high note, securing a victory against the Green Bay Packers.
